The forecast for re-imports of spray guns and similar appliances to Canada from 2024 to 2028 exhibits a steady year-on-year increase in value, beginning at 354.66 thousand US dollars in 2024 and reaching 424.46 thousand US dollars by 2028.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) over this period is approximately 4.5%. As of 2023, the value of these imports stood significantly lower, underscoring a positive trend in demand.
Future trends to watch for include:
- Technological advancements in spray equipment that may influence demand and import needs.
- Shifts in Canadian manufacturing industries that rely on these appliances, potentially driving re-import volumes.
- Global economic conditions and trade policies that may impact the flow and cost efficiency of re-import activities.
